🌱Natural Material:
Made from 100% natural, unglazed clay, this pot is safe for health and environmentally friendly, free from synthetic additives.
💪Healthy Drinking Option: 
This Clay water pot  also called as Matka is free from harmful chemicals, ensuring that your drinking experience is both healthy and flavorful. Additionally, the lid effectively protects the liquid inside from dust and other impurities, ensuring freshness and cleanliness.
🧊 Self-Cooling Benefit: 
The porous structure of the clay pot allows water to cool naturally, giving you refreshing, chilled water without the need for refrigeration.
🧼 Maintenance & Care Tips
Keep your clay water pot fresh by changing the water regularly. Clean it gently using a soft cloth or sponge—avoid harsh soaps and never use a dishwasher. Make sure the pot is completely dry before storing to prevent any smell or mold. As it’s a handmade product crafted from natural clay, handle it with care to maintain its durability.
